Saab 99 crash on the B430 - 29 May 1992

Accident reference 199243P118052

Slight Accident

Accident summary

On Friday 29 May 1992 at 08:45 a slight collision occurred near B430 involving 2 vehicles (saab 99)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as raining no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- no lighting.
